FWIW, NFLX sees performance close to that of cxgbe (by far the best
maintained, best performing FreeBSD 40G driver) with an iflib
converted driver. The iflib updated driver will be imported by 11 but
won't become the default driver until 11.1 for wont of QA resources at
Intel.
